Pre-Planning Checklist
Before you book a florist, use this checklist to keep decisions clear and stress low. Start by confirming your wedding style, color palette, and overall vibe—romantic, modern, garden-inspired, or classic. Next, outline what you need: bridal bouquet, bridesmaid bouquets, boutonnieres, corsages, ceremony pieces, and reception centerpieces. Finally, decide on fragrance sensitivity and any allergies so your selections feel comfortable for everyone.
Choose the Right Florals and Quantities
Reliable wedding flower planning depends on accurate quantities. List each floral piece by name and count, including extras for photos, family members, and any special moments like a unity arrangement or aisle markers. If you want a cohesive look, select a hero flower and a supporting mix, then decide how much filler and greenery you prefer. Ask your florist about seasonal availability and substitutions that still match your intended colors and textures.
Confirm Budget, Delivery, and Setup Details
A smooth experience depends on logistics as much as design. Set a realistic budget range and identify priorities: more impact at the ceremony, fuller centerpieces, or a standout bridal bouquet. Request a clear breakdown of what’s included—labor, delivery, setup, and any container rentals. Discuss how arrangements will be transported and staged so they remain secure and fresh. If your venue has restrictions (tablescapes, open flames, or size limits), confirm those details early. If you’re coordinating with a planner or venue staff, align on timing for drop-off, placement, and final touchups.
